Jersey Number 24
Marcus Mitchell
- Position:
- F
- Ht./Wt.:
- 6-7 / 225
- Class:
- Redshirt Senior
- Hometown:
- Memphis, Tenn.
- High School:
- Germantown HS
2019-20 (Junior): Redshirted during the 2019-20 season due to NCAA transfer rules.
2018-19 (Sophomore at Mississippi Valley State): Played in 18 games, starting in five contests … Averaged 3.8 points and 2.6 rebounds per game while shooting 41.9 percent from the field … Tallied a season-high seven points on four occasions, including his Division I debut at Nebraska … Pulled down a season-high seven rebounds coming off the bench against Southeast Missouri State.
2017-18 (Freshman at Columbia State CC): Played in 30 games and earned one start for the Chargers … Averaged 5.6 points and 5.3 rebounds per outing, shooting 52.3 percent from the field … Turned in perhaps his best outing at Cumberland, pouring a career-high 20 points and grabbing a career-high 14 rebounds
2016-17 (Freshman at Southern Arkansas): Began his career in collegiate athletics on the gridiron as a quarterback at Southern Arkansas.
Germantown HS: Lettered in both football and basketball for the Red Devils.
Personal: Born Feb. 9, 1998 in Memphis, Tenn. … Son of Marcus and Christine Mitchell … Has one brother, Cameron … Majoring in Communications … Favorite food is pizza and wings … Favorite athlete is LeBron James … Favorite book is Glory Road.
